Wedding bells ring at the William McIlrath War Memorial Chapel

The first wedding in the William McIlrath War Memorial Chapel was the marriage of Mr Peter Wood (OKG54) (dec'd) and Miss Barbara de Groot on 22 November 1962. Peter was a Knox student from 1947 to 1954 and was the Honorary Secretary of the Old Knox Grammarians' Association from 1958 to 1961.

The ceremony was conducted in the evening and presided over by Reverend D Flockhart. The Daily Telegraph reported two of the listed groomsmen were also Knox Old Boys of the 1954 graduating class, Peter Conde and Michael Blackwell.

Knox Grammar School has been a part of the Wood Family for three generations. Not long after their marriage, Peter and Barbara baptised their first child in the Chapel. Peter’s son Antony (OKG83) and grandson Harry (OKG19) also went on to attend Knox.
